Proposal

T1 Ash - Remove to ground level and poison with eco plugs as showing signs of Ash Dieback. Reasons: tree is showing signs of disease T2 Copper Beech - Remove major deadwood and crown lift over garden to give 3.5m clearance from ground level, cut back from vicarage to give 2m clearance. Reasons: to give clearance for pedestrians G5 self-seeded Cherries - Cut back from the property to give 2m clearance. Reasons: to give 2-3m clearance from the property T4 Beech - Sever ivy, clear away from telephone pole and wires to give 1m clearance. Reasons: to give clearance from telephone wires. T5 Sycamore - Remove epicormic growth around base of tree, cut back from telephone wires to give 1m clearance. Reasons: to give clearance from telephone wires T8 large Oak - Clear lamp post to give 1m clearance, remove major deadwood over 40mm diameter. Reasons: to give clearance from utility line and remove epicormic growth

About tree works applications

Applications for works to trees cover protected trees: consent under a tree preservation order, or six weeks notice for trees in a conservation area. More in our guide to planning application types.
